在Golang中,可以使用net/http包来发送HTTP请求并附加cert.pem和key.pem。 首先,你需要将cert.pem和key.pem文件加载到内存中。可以使用ioutil.ReadFile()函数读取文件的内容,并将其存储在字节切片中。 代码语言:txt 复制 cert, err := ioutil.ReadFile("cert.pem") if err != nil { log.Fatal(e...
一种是 Base64 (ASCII) 编码的文本格式。这种证书文件是可以通过文本编辑器打开,甚至进行编辑,常见有 PEM 证书格式,扩展名包括 PEM、CRT 和 KEY。 另外一种是 Binary 二进制文件。常见有 DER 证书格式,扩展名包括 DER 和 CER。 Linux 系统使用 CRT,Windows 系统使用 CER。 生成CA 的私钥(后缀名可以用 .pem ...
1、生成RSA密钥的方法 openssl genrsa -des3 -out key.pem 2048 这个命令会生成一个2048位的密钥,同时有一个des3方法加密的密码,如果你不想要每次都输入密码,可以改成: openssl genrsa -out key.pem 2048 建议用2048位密钥,少于此可能会不安全或很快将不安全。 2、生成一个证书请求 openssl req -new -key...
apiclient_cert.pem apiclient_key.pem 因为go目前不支持解析p12(博主没找到示例代码), 所以只能使用下面两个。 getClient := func() *http.Client { var wechatPayCert = "C:\\Users\\DELL\\Desktop\\LINUX-CERT\\apiclient_cert.pem" var wechatPayKey = "C:\\Users\\DELL\\Desktop\\LINUX-CERT\\...
您好!apiclient_key.pem和apiclient_cert.pem是配置退款的校验文件,如果只设置支付功能,该两项可以跳过(可选),但如果需要实现退款的话该两项必须设置。具体的设置方法可以 您好!apiclient_key.pem和apiclient_cert.pem是配置退款的校验文件,如果只设置支付功能,该两项可以跳过(可选),但如果需要实现退款的话该两...
1,首先扫码登录微信支付官网https://pay.weixin.qq.com2,操作路径:【账户中心】-【API安全】最终得到的zip压缩包,解压出来四个文件,只需要apiclient_cert.pem,apiclient_key.pem这两个文件
这里有坑 配置环境变量就和python一样了 第二天我会上传到工作群,openssl安装包 2.生成证书 o ...
如果你需要在helm和tiller之间进行TLS,请点击此链接https://github.com/helm/helm/blob/master/docs/...
pem文件是服务器向苹果服务器做推送时候需要的文件,主要是给php向苹果服务器验证时使用,下面介绍一下pem文件的生成。 2、生成pem文件步骤 1、打开钥匙串,选择需要生成的推送证书 image 2、将certificate和private key导出得到.p12文件 2.1、生成证书apns-dev-cert.p12的p12文件,按照下面操作导出p12,桌面对应生成apns-...
根据您的描述,您似乎打算创建私钥/公钥并为API调用设置SSL。这里有一个关于如何完成此操作的简明指南:...